Public bug reported: After upgrade, the Unity Dash was only showing the social lens on pressing the Super key; pressing the lens-specific key combinations (e.g. Super+A for Applications) did not work.
After removing unity-lens-friends, there are now no lenses, and pressing Super brings up the Dash with a spinner next to the text box that never stops, and a blank content area.
